Job Description We currently have an opening for a Hydrologist in our Vernon or Kelowna office with our Water and Climate Services Group. This position may be based in one of our other major offices (e.g. Edmonton, Calgary or Vancouver), please indicate your preferred location in your cover letter. You will be responsible for providing technical expertise and guidance on hydrology projects, and for supporting on a wide range of water science projects (including water resources, water quality, and climate and climate change; experience in one or multiple areas considered an asset). Responsibilities include the following: Carrying out hydrometric monitoring and stream channel surveys and assessments. Performing a broad range of technical hydrologic, hydraulic, and planning assessments. Managing and/or coordinating projects, including scoping, budgeting, client liaison, and leading project teams. Contributing to or leading the preparation of high quality scientific and technical reports. Collaborating on multi-disciplinary projects where hydrologic evaluations inform design and risk management. Supporting work in water-related fields (such as water quality, watershed management, and drought risk assessments). Job Requirements Critical attributes for this role include strong technical and communication skills, an analytical focus with attention to detail, and a commitment to support the development of other professionals. What you will bring: Undergraduate degree (B.Sc.) in hydrology, physical geography, or earth science; graduate (M.Sc.) degree preferred. Minimum of 5 years' post-graduation experience in environmental consulting or applied research. Professional registration (e.g. P.Geo., P.Ag.) or eligible to be registered within 1 year. Experience working safely in remote areas and extreme environments and weather conditions. Excellent written and verbal communication skills. Experience working with large and complex datasets.
